Transaction 8667c504a841af006b3eacd1d11b42bd92bd99a22f25223527c832520aeb6f21

1 Input
2 Outputs
  • 8667c504a841af006b3eacd1d11b42bd92bd99a22f25223527c832520aeb6f21:0
  • value  553300
    address  154M4CqP3BSGMXxhfM3B7SyVsX7mxAWgZe
  • 8667c504a841af006b3eacd1d11b42bd92bd99a22f25223527c832520aeb6f21:1
  • value  45175
    address  11D6yhFm15xgRb5sEqYGjvGDwCMuTQck3